When designing a property landscape, one of the most crucial step is to put an intend on paper. Developing a master plan will certainly save you time and money and is more likely to lead to a successful design. A plan of attack is developed with the 'layout process': a detailed method that thinks about the ecological conditions, your needs, and the aspects and principles of design.

The 5 steps of the style procedure consist of: 1) conducting a site supply and evaluation, 2) determining your needs, 3) developing useful diagrams, 4) developing conceptual design plans, and 5) attracting a last design plan. The initial 3 actions establish the visual, practical, and gardening demands for the layout. The last 2 steps then apply those demands to the creation of the last landscape plan.

Topography and water drainage must additionally be noted and all water drainage problems fixed in the proposed layout. An excellent layout will certainly move water away from the residence and re-route it to visit various other locations of the lawn. Environment concerns start with temperature level: plants need to have the ability to make it through the average high and, most notably, the ordinary reduced temperature levels for the region.


Sun/shade patterns, the amount and length of exposure to sun or shade (Number 1), create microclimates (sometimes called microhabitats). Recording website conditions and existing plant life on a base map will disclose the location of microclimates in the lawn. Plants typically drop into a couple of of 4 microclimate categories-full sun, partial shade, color, and deep color.

This is called "sense of location", which implies it fits with the environments. There are both form themes and style themes. Every yard ought to have a form style, yet not all yards have a style motif. As a matter of fact, numerous residential yards have no particular style other than to blend with the home by duplicating details from the design such as materials, color, and form.


In a form theme the organization and form of the areas in the yard is based either on the shape of the home, the form of the areas between your house and the property limits, or a favored shape of the property owner. The form motif figures out the shape and organization (the format) of the spaces and the links in between them.
